Newcastle United have announced that they will be making a nine-day tour of the United States next month as part of their pre-season preparation for the 2015/16 season.

The trip will include three matches against Mexican side Club Atlas in Milwaukee on July 14 before heading to California to play Sacramento Republic FC on July 18.

The Geordies’ final fixture will come on July 21 against Portland Timbers at Providence Park.

Managing Director at the Newcastle United Lee Charnley has expressed his happiness at securing the three friendly matches to be held in the United States.

Charnley said: “We are delighted to have secured these three matches in the US as part of our pre-season schedule. This trip will play a key part in getting the team’s fitness and preparation absolutely right ahead of the new season.

“It will also enable us to build on last year’s successful tour of New Zealand; helping us develop and strengthen the Newcastle United brand internationally and reach new audiences as we seek to increase our global fan base.

“The US is a key territory for the Premier League and the huge increase in the numbers of US viewers watching Premier League games over the last couple of seasons mean this is a perfect time for us to head across the Atlantic.

“We also know we have a number of strong and enthusiastic fan groups based in the States and we look forward to engaging with as many of them as possible them during this tour.”
